Cracked foundation repair services involve assessing and restoring the structural integrity of a building's foundation when cracks or other damage are present. These services typically include evaluating the extent of the damage, determining the underlying causes, and implementing appropriate repair techniques. Common methods may involve epoxy injections to seal cracks, underpinning to stabilize the foundation, or installing pier systems to lift and support the structure. The goal is to prevent further deterioration and maintain the safety and stability of the property.
Cracks in a foundation can lead to a range of issues, including uneven floors, sticking doors or windows, and noticeable shifts in the building's alignment. If left unaddressed, foundation problems can cause significant structural damage and reduce the property's value. Foundation repair services help mitigate these risks by addressing the root causes of the cracks, such as soil movement, settling, or water damage. Proper repair can help preserve the property's integrity and prevent costly repairs in the future.

The overview below groups typical Cracked Foundation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Germantown, MD.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Foundation Repair Costs - Typical expenses range from $2,000 to $7,000 depending on the extent of the damage and repair method. For minor cracks, costs may be closer to $2,000, while major foundation stabilization can exceed $7,000.
Material and Method Variations - Costs vary based on whether epoxy injections, piering, or underpinning are used. Epoxy repairs often cost between $1,500 and $4,000, whereas piering can range from $3,500 to over $10,000.
Location and Accessibility - Repair costs can fluctuate depending on property location and accessibility. In areas like Germantown, MD, prices generally align with regional averages but can be higher for hard-to-reach foundations.
Additional Expenses - Extra costs may include excavation, drainage improvements, or soil stabilization. These additional services can add $1,000 to $5,000 to the total cost, depending on the scope of work.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s of a foundation in need of repair? Indicators include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ven or sloping floors, gaps around windows or doors, and sticking or misaligned doors and windows.
How do professionals typically repair cracked foundations? Repair methods may involve epoxy injections, underpinning, or wall anchors, depending on the severity and type of foundation damage.
Can foundation issues be prevented? While some factors are unavoidable, proper drainage, maintaining soil stability, and addressing minor cracks early can help reduce the risk of major problems.
